Understanding Dubai's July Climate
The Dubai climate in July is characterized by intense heat and high humidity. This is the core of the summer season in Dubai, and the weather is a key factor to consider when planning your itinerary.
July Temperature in Dubai
The July temperature in Dubai is extreme. You can expect average high temperatures to soar well above 40°C (104°F). It is not uncommon for the mercury to reach 45°C (113°F) on the hottest days. At night, the Dubai temperature in July offers little relief, with lows hovering around 30°C (86°F). This high dubai july temp, combined with the humidity, can make the heat feel even more intense.
Weather Patterns
The Dubai weather in July features very little rainfall, with the sun shining for the vast majority of the month. The sea temperature is also very warm, at approximately 32°C (90°F), which is like a hot bath and perfect for a refreshing dip in a temperature-controlled pool or beach club.
Summer Season in Dubai
The summer season in Dubai officially runs from June to September. During these Dubai summer months, the city shifts its focus to indoor activities and nightlife. This is when you'll find the best deals on flights and hotels, making it a prime time for savvy travelers.

What to Pack for a Dubai Trip in July?Â
- Packing correctly is essential to ensure you stay comfortable and stylish during the Dubai summer months. Here’s a checklist for your suitcase:
- Lightweight Clothing: Choose loose-fitting clothes made of breathable fabrics like cotton or linen. This will help you stay cooler when moving between air-conditioned spaces.
- Sun Protection: The sun is extremely strong. Pack a high-SPF sunscreen, a wide-brimmed hat, and UV-protection sunglasses.
- Comfortable Footwear: You'll be doing a lot of walking in massive shopping malls and indoor theme parks, so comfortable walking shoes are a must.
- Swimwear: A swimsuit is essential for enjoying hotel pools, waterparks, or the warm sea.
- Reusable Water Bottle: Staying hydrated is the most important rule for the Dubai weather in July. Carry water with you at all times.
- Modest Cover-up: When visiting religious sites or local markets, it’s respectful to cover your shoulders and knees. A light scarf or shawl is perfect for this.
Top Things to Do in Dubai in July
The high July temperature in Dubai makes it the perfect time to explore the city's world-class indoor attractions. While the heat limits traditional outdoor sightseeing, Dubai's innovation shines through its incredible indoor destinations.
- Visit the Burj Khalifa: Experience breathtaking views from the observation decks of the world's tallest building, all from the comfort of a fully air-conditioned environment.
- Shop 'til You Drop: Take advantage of the famous Dubai Summer Surprises (DSS), a city-wide event featuring huge sales, live entertainment, and family activities. Explore massive malls like The Dubai Mall and Mall of the Emirates, which are practically mini-cities themselves.
- Ski in the Desert: At Ski Dubai, you can enjoy a real indoor ski slope, complete with snow, penguins, and ski lifts, which is the ultimate way to beat the Dubai climate in July.
- Explore the Aquarium: The Dubai Aquarium & Underwater Zoo, located in The Dubai Mall, is a mesmerizing indoor attraction where you can walk through a tunnel surrounded by sharks and rays.
- Immerse in Culture: Visit the Museum of the Future or the Dubai Frame for a dose of culture and history in a cool environment.
- Experience a Night Safari: For a taste of the desert, opt for an evening or nighttime desert safari when the Dubai temperature in July drops slightly, allowing for a more comfortable and magical experience under the stars.

Essential Visitor Tips for a July Trip
Planning a trip during the Dubai summer months requires a smart approach. Here are some pro-tips to make the most of your Dubai in July adventure:
- Plan Your Day: Schedule all outdoor excursions for the early morning or late evening.
- Maximize Indoor Time: During the peak heat of the afternoon (12 p.m. to 4 p.m.), it's wise to be in an air-conditioned space.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water to compensate for fluid loss due to the heat.
- Use Taxis or the Metro: The Dubai Metro is a fantastic, air-conditioned way to travel and is ideal for the hot Dubai weather in July.
- Book in Advance: Even though it's the off-season, popular indoor attractions can get busy, so booking tickets online is a good idea.

Popular Foods to Try in July in Dubai
When visiting Dubai, try popular dishes like Shawarma (grilled meat wraps), Falafel (fried chickpea balls), and Hummus (a dip made from chickpeas). You can also enjoy delicious sweets like Baklava (sweet pastry) and Luqaimat (sweet dumplings). Don’t forget to try fresh fruit juices.
